Dr. Kariuki has been sued by a patient for a criminal act under section 243 of the penal code Cap 63 of Kenya (Reckless and negligent acts).
"A person who in a manner so rash or negligent as to endanger human life or to be likely to cause harm to any other person:
Gives medical or surgical treatment to any person whom he has undertaken to treat, or
Dispenses, supplies, sells, administers or gives away any medicine or poisonous or dangerous matter
Is guilty of a misdemeanor."
Advice Dr. Kariuki on the available defenses. (20 Marks)
